The one you were looking would be the Archos Video Player (SA) which is meant for use on OTHER devices (not for any Archos devices).
There are 2 other ones also:
The Archos Video Player (TI) which is ONLY for the Archos 101XS with Jelly Bean firmware.
The Archos Video Player (RK) which is ONLY for the Archos 80XS and the Archos GamePad.
There is nothing new or improved in any of them. All they are is reworked versions of the exact same one that is already in the Archos 4.0.26 firmware upgrade for the 80 G9 and 101 G9 tablets. So, even if you could get one of these and some manage to get it to install, you would not be gaining anything (other than shelling out $4.99 for something you already have on your G9 tablet).

Does it skip using the Music App that came with the Archos?
There was a discussion (can't remember if it was on XDA or ArchosFan forum) that said only a handful of music players work correctly with the HDD.
PowerAMP was one of the ones that had troubles with the HDD.
Edit - Found the Post, it includes some music apps that work well with 250GB models. The post suggests gonemads player or rockbox as alternatives: http://forum.archosfans.com/viewtopic.php?f=84&t=62440
